How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Payne County?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Payne County Studio Apartments | $1,350 | $900 | $1,800 |
Payne County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$813 | $564 | $1,211 |
Payne County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,016 | $595 | $4,560 |
Payne County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,016 | $485 | $1,274 |
Payne County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,097 | $480 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Payne County Apartments
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Payne County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Payne County is $813.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Payne County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Payne County is a 665 square feet unit starting from $895 at The Links at Stillwater I/II.
What is the average size for Payne County 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Payne County is currently 643 sq ft.
